Hedge planting services involve the installation of living barriers made from a variety of shrub or tree species to create privacy, define property boundaries, or enhance the landscape. These services typically include selecting suitable plants based on the property’s location and aesthetic goals, preparing the soil, planting the hedges with proper spacing, and providing initial care to ensure healthy growth. Professional contractors can help homeowners achieve a natural, attractive boundary that requires minimal ongoing maintenance once established, making it a practical choice for those looking to improve their outdoor space.

Hedge planting can address several common property concerns. For example, it can act as a sound barrier to reduce noise from nearby streets or neighbors, or serve as a windbreak to protect gardens and outdoor living areas. Additionally, a well-placed hedge can increase privacy, especially in densely built neighborhoods or close-proximity properties. Properly installed hedges can also improve curb appeal by adding greenery and structure to the landscape, which can be beneficial for homeowners considering property value or aesthetic upgrades.

The overview below groups typical Hedge Planting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Simi Valley,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Hedge Planting - For planting a few small hedges or shrubs,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ering basic installation and minimal materials.

Medium-Sized Hedge Installation - Larger projects involving several rows of mature hedges generally c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ects are common for landscaping upgrades and boundary definitions in residential yards.

Full Hedge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of existing hedges can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the landscape.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ive hedge planting for commercial properties or large estates may exceed $5,000, especially when involving advanced planning, heavy equipment, or specialized plant varieties. Such projects are less frequent but handled by experienced local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
